package api
import (
"context"
restful "github.com/emicklei/go-restful/v3"
"k8s.io/klog/v2"
"github.com/oam-dev/kubevela/pkg/apiserver/domain/model"
"github.com/oam-dev/kubevela/pkg/apiserver/domain/service"
apis "github.com/oam-dev/kubevela/pkg/apiserver/interfaces/api/dto/v1"
"github.com/oam-dev/kubevela/pkg/apiserver/utils"
"github.com/oam-dev/kubevela/pkg/apiserver/utils/bcode"
)
// Workflow workflow api
type Workflow struct {
WorkflowService service.WorkflowService `inject:""`
ApplicationService service.ApplicationService `inject:""`
}
// NewWorkflow new workflow api interface
func NewWorkflow() interface{} {
return &Workflow{}
}
func (w *Workflow) workflowCheckFilter(req *restful.Request, res *restful.Response, chain *restful.FilterChain) {
app := req.Request.Context().Value(&apis.CtxKeyApplication).(*model.Application)
workflow, err := w.WorkflowService.GetWorkflow(req.Request.Context(), app, req.PathParameter("workflowName"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
req.Request = req.Request.WithContext(context.WithValue(req.Request.Context(), &apis.CtxKeyWorkflow, workflow))
chain.ProcessFilter(req, res)
}
func (w *Workflow) workflowRecordCheckFilter(req *restful.Request, res *restful.Response, chain *restful.FilterChain) {
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
record, err := w.WorkflowService.GetWorkflowRecord(req.Request.Context(), workflow, req.PathParameter("record"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
req.Request = req.Request.WithContext(context.WithValue(req.Request.Context(), &apis.CtxKeyWorkflowRecord, record))
chain.ProcessFilter(req, res)
}
func (w *Workflow) listApplicationWorkflows(req *restful.Request, res *restful.Response) {
app := req.Request.Context().Value(&apis.CtxKeyApplication).(*model.Application)
workflows, err := w.WorkflowService.ListApplicationWorkflow(req.Request.Context(), app)
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(apis.ListWorkflowResponse{Workflows: workflows});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) createOrUpdateApplicationWorkflow(req *restful.Request, res *restful.Response) {
// Verify the validity of parameters
var createReq apis.CreateWorkflowRequest
if err := req.ReadEntity(&createReq); err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:= validate.Struct(&createReq); err != nil {
bcode.ReturnError(req, res, err)
return
}
app := req.Request.Context().Value(&apis.CtxKeyApplication).(*model.Application)
// Call the domain service layer code
workflowDetail, err := w.WorkflowService.CreateOrUpdateWorkflow(req.Request.Context(), app, createReq)
if err != nil {
klog.Errorf("create application failure %s", err.Error())
bcode.ReturnError(req, res, err)
return
}
// Write back response data
if err := res.WriteEntity(workflowDetail);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) detailWorkflow(req *restful.Request, res *restful.Response) {
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
detail, err := w.WorkflowService.DetailWorkflow(req.Request.Context(), workflow)
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(detail);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) updateWorkflow(req *restful.Request, res *restful.Response) {
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
// Verify the validity of parameters
var updateReq apis.UpdateWorkflowRequest
if err := req.ReadEntity(&updateReq); err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:= validate.Struct(&updateReq); err != nil {
bcode.ReturnError(req, res, err)
return
}
detail, err := w.WorkflowService.UpdateWorkflow(req.Request.Context(), workflow, updateReq)
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(detail);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) deleteWorkflow(req *restful.Request, res *restful.Response) {
app := req.Request.Context().Value(&apis.CtxKeyApplication).(*model.Application)
if err := w.WorkflowService.DeleteWorkflow(req.Request.Context(), app, req.PathParameter("workflowName")); err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(apis.EmptyResponse{});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) listWorkflowRecords(req *restful.Request, res *restful.Response) {
page, pageSize, err := utils.ExtractPagingParams(req, minPageSize, maxPageSize)
if err != nil {
bcode.ReturnError(req, res, err)
return
}
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
records, err := w.WorkflowService.ListWorkflowRecords(req.Request.Context(), workflow, page, pageSize)
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(records);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) detailWorkflowRecord(req *restful.Request, res *restful.Response) {
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
record, err := w.WorkflowService.DetailWorkflowRecord(req.Request.Context(), workflow, req.PathParameter("record"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(record);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) resumeWorkflowRecord(req *restful.Request, res *restful.Response) {
app := req.Request.Context().Value(&apis.CtxKeyApplication).(*model.Application)
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
err := w.WorkflowService.ResumeRecord(req.Request.Context(), app, workflow, req.PathParameter("record"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(apis.EmptyResponse{});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) terminateWorkflowRecord(req *restful.Request, res *restful.Response) {
app := req.Request.Context().Value(&apis.CtxKeyApplication).(*model.Application)
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
err := w.WorkflowService.TerminateRecord(req.Request.Context(), app, workflow, req.PathParameter("record"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(apis.EmptyResponse{});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) rollbackWorkflowRecord(req *restful.Request, res *restful.Response) {
app := req.Request.Context().Value(&apis.CtxKeyApplication).(*model.Application)
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
record, err := w.WorkflowService.RollbackRecord(req.Request.Context(), app, workflow, req.PathParameter("record"), req.QueryParameter("rollbackVersion"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(record);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) getWorkflowRecordLogs(req *restful.Request, res *restful.Response) {
record := req.Request.Context().Value(&apis.CtxKeyWorkflowRecord).(*model.WorkflowRecord)
logResponse, err := w.WorkflowService.GetWorkflowRecordLog(req.Request.Context(), record, req.QueryParameter("step"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(logResponse);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) getWorkflowRecordInputs(req *restful.Request, res *restful.Response) {
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
record := req.Request.Context().Value(&apis.CtxKeyWorkflowRecord).(*model.WorkflowRecord)
inputs, err := w.WorkflowService.GetWorkflowRecordInput(req.Request.Context(), workflow, record, req.QueryParameter("step"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(inputs);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
func (w *Workflow) getWorkflowRecordOutputs(req *restful.Request, res *restful.Response) {
workflow := req.Request.Context().Value(&apis.CtxKeyWorkflow).(*model.Workflow)
record := req.Request.Context().Value(&apis.CtxKeyWorkflowRecord).(*model.WorkflowRecord)
outputRes, err := w.WorkflowService.GetWorkflowRecordOutput(req.Request.Context(), workflow, record, req.QueryParameter("step"))
if err != nil {
bcode.ReturnError(req, res, err)
return
}
if err := res.WriteEntity(outputRes); err != nil {
bcode.ReturnError(req, res, err)
return
}
}
